Report Title:

Firearms; Defense

 

Description:

Provides a defense to prosecution under place to keep provisions based on justifiable use of force in self-protection or justifiable use of force for the protection of another person.

A BILL FOR AN ACT

 

 

relating to firearms.

 

 

B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F HAWAII:

 


     SECTION 1.  Chapter 134, Hawaii Revised Statutes, is amended by adding a new section to be appropriately designated and to read as follows:

     "§134-    Defense.  It is a defense to prosecution under sections 134-23 to 134-27 that the person possessed, displayed or used a firearm in justifiable use of force in self-protection or in justifiable use of force for the protection of another person during the commission of a crime in which that person or the other person protected was a victim."

     SECTION 2.  This act does not affect rights and duties that matured, penalties that were incurred, and proceedings that were begun, before its effective date.

     SECTION 3.  New statutory material is underscored.

     SECTION 4.  This Act shall take effect upon its approval.
